Fly High Pro X Series wakeboard ballast bags were the first products designed from the ground up to be used in a wakeboard boat. Starting with a blank canvas, Fly High was able to rethink nearly every aspect of wakeboard ballast bag constructions and functionality. Gone are the day of two part construction, leaky waterbed connections, and fittings that are difficult to connect.

By building their wakeboard ballast bags from a single layer of durable yet flexible vinyl, the same material that is used to build white water rafts, Fly High is able to offer unmatched strength and durability in an easy to use package.

How much extra weight would it take to get the diamond hull to sink down like the wakesetter. The price on the boat is good but maybe I should wait for a wakesetter if its going to take a lot to get a good wake. Mainly what I was trying to say is that it may be easier to make your own than to find a boat with the factory MLS.

Don't pass up a boat you like just because it doesn't have the factory MLS. Good wakes are subjective, I think my DD with lbs and the wedge is pretty awesome, where someone with a SAN and lbs would tell you it sucks. My guess would be you would need anywhere from lbs more to get the same wake out of a diamond hull than a non-diamond hull.

Keep in mind that I base this on what I've read and not what I have actually experienced, so someone more knowledgable may chime in.
